Software Engineer
Quanterix
Company Description
Founded in 2007, Quanterix is developing an ultra-sensitive diagnostic platform capable of measuring individual proteins at concentrations 1000 times lower than the best immunoassays available today. The Single Molecule Array (Simoa™) technology at the heart of the platform enables the detection and quantification of biomarkers previously difficult or impossible to measure, opening up new applications to address significant unmet needs in life science research, in-vitro diagnostics, companion diagnostics, blood screening, and more. Quanterix is a venture capital backed company and the exclusive licensee of a broad intellectual property portfolio initially developed at Tufts University by Dr. David Walt, scientific founder of Quanterix and Illumina (NASDAQ: ILMN).
Job Description
Are you currently utilizing your scientific programming and image analysis skills to develop ground breaking scientific tools with the latest technology?
We are a start-up on a fast trajectory to disrupt the diagnostics market with a single molecule sensitive instrument. Come join a diverse, dynamic and highly experienced group of scientists and engineers who are dedicated to excellence and successful launch a commercial platform. Here is what we are we looking for…
Key Responsibilities:
- Design and implement a data warehousing solution to collect and organize vast amount of data generated by company’s biological analyzers.
- Create a web-based data mining platform to enable data analytics and reporting that will drive business and engineering decisions.
- Prioritize, design, plan, implement, and own features centered on data analysis.
- Work with internal and external customers on improving current features.
- Solve challenging problems in algorithms, scalability, performance, and API design.
- Peer review of code, development processes, and system architectures.
Qualifications
Required Skills & Experience
- Flexible, curiosity-driven, self-starting developer with excellent cross-disciplinary teamwork and communication skills.
- Knowledge of SQL, SQL Server and data warehousing techniques.
- Experience working with very large data sets.
- Strong programming skills in at least one of the following languages: C#, Java, C++, C.
- Knowledge of a web-development platform for rapid deployment of data-centric applications.
- Experience designing and developing algorithms to efficiently process terabytes of data.
- Familiarity with development tools: version control, bug tracking, Visual Studio, ReSharper, NUnit.
- Fundamental software concepts: the software development life cycle; concurrent programming; object-oriented programming; functional programming; database storage; data structures; server/client model; MVC in UI.
- BS, MS or PhD in Computer Science or a related Engineering discipline.
- Years of experience? We are looking for excellence. If you have previously released commercial software, we would like to talk to you.
Desired Skills & Experience
- Computer science, math or biochemistry background is a big plus.
- Scientific computing, machine learning
- Data analytics, statistics and probability
- Experience with C, C++, and LINQ or asynchronous methods in .NET 4.5 and ImageJ experience.
- Familiarity with dependency injection, test-driven development, object-relational mapping, mocking, or continuous integration.
Lexington, MA 02421
Full Time